Meta Ad Specs: Sizes, Ratios and the Ones That Matter

Updated September 2026 · Written and maintained by the Progression Agency strategy team

Meta publishes dozens of specifications across Facebook and Instagram placements, and most of them do not matter. A small number do: the aspect ratios that decide whether your ad fills the screen or floats in a letterbox, the safe zones that keep text from being covered by interface elements, and the file requirements that quietly downgrade your video before anyone sees it. This page separates the specifications worth designing around from the ones the platform will handle for you.

The short answerDesign to 4:5 for feed and 9:16 for Stories and Reels, and you have covered the overwhelming majority of delivery. Those two ratios take the most screen space in their respective placements, which is the single spec decision with a measurable effect. Keep text and logos out of roughly the top and bottom fourteen percent of any vertical asset, because interface elements sit there. Upload video at the highest quality you have rather than pre-compressing it, since the platform re-encodes anyway and compressing twice only costs you quality. Everything else on the specification sheet is a limit to stay inside rather than a decision to make.

The specs that actually change results
Five decisions cover almost all of the practical value in a specification sheet that runs to dozens of entries. The rest are ceilings to stay under rather than choices to make.

What are the Meta ad specs that actually matter?

Five: use 4:5 in feed, 9:16 in Stories and Reels, keep text out of the safe zones, upload at source quality, and caption every video. The rest of the specification sheet is a set of limits rather than decisions.

Why 4:5 rather than square in the feed

A 4:5 asset occupies more vertical space on a phone screen than a 1:1 asset does, and screen space is one of the few variables creative controls outright. The difference is not enormous and it is free, which makes it the easiest specification decision on the list.

Why 9:16 rather than a cropped feed asset

Stories and Reels are full-screen surfaces. An asset that does not fill them either gets letterboxed with blank space or auto-cropped in a way the designer did not choose. Producing a genuine vertical cut is more work and it is the difference between an ad that belongs in the surface and one that visibly does not.

Why safe zones survived when other specs did not

Automatic format adaptation has improved to the point where the platform handles most ratio problems acceptably. What it cannot do is move your headline out from under a profile picture or a call-to-action button, which is why the safe zone is the specification most worth designing around and the one most often ignored.

What are the current image specifications?

Recommended minimum width around 1080 pixels, ratios of 4:5 for feed, 1:1 as a fallback, 9:16 for vertical placements, JPG or PNG, and a file size ceiling well above anything a properly exported image will reach.

Image specifications by placement
PlacementRecommended ratioMinimum widthNotes
Facebook feed4:5 or 1:11080px4:5 uses more screen
Instagram feed4:5 or 1:11080pxSame reasoning applies
Stories9:161080pxKeep text clear of both safe zones
Reels9:161080pxStatic images underperform video here
Marketplace1:11080pxProduct clarity matters more than styling
Right column1.91:1600pxSmall rendering; avoid fine detail
Audience Network9:16 or 1:11080pxRendering varies by publisher
Explore4:5 or 1:11080pxBehaves like feed

The file size and format entries on Meta’s own sheet are ceilings rather than targets. Any image exported at reasonable quality from any modern tool sits comfortably inside them, which is why they rarely need thinking about.

Resolution: more is fine, less is not

Uploading a larger image than the minimum costs nothing and protects you when the platform renders at a size you did not anticipate. Uploading below the minimum produces visible softness on high-density screens, which is most of them.

Text on images: no longer a rule, still a factor

Meta previously rejected or throttled images where text covered more than roughly twenty percent of the area. That enforcement was removed. Heavy text still tends to perform worse because it reads as an advertisement at a glance, so treat it as a design decision now rather than a compliance one.

What are the current video specifications?

MP4 or MOV, H.264 video with AAC audio, 9:16 or 4:5 depending on placement, at least 1080 pixels wide, and a generous file size ceiling. Upload the best master you have and let the platform compress.

Video specifications and what each constraint really means
SpecificationTypical requirementWhat it means in practice
ContainerMP4 or MOVAny standard export from any editor
CodecH.264 video, AAC audioThe default in every editor’s presets
Ratio9:16 vertical, 4:5 feedProduce both from one vertical master
Resolution1080px wide minimumHigher is fine and usually better
Frame rateUp to 60fps30fps is fine for most content
LengthVaries widely by placementShorter almost always outperforms
CaptionsOptional to the platform, essential in practiceMost viewing is muted
File sizeA large ceilingDo not compress to get under it

The last row is the one people get wrong. Compressing a video to reach a smaller file size before uploading means it gets compressed twice, once by you and once by the platform, and the artefacts from the first pass are baked in before the second begins.

Length limits versus useful length

Placements permit far longer video than performs well. The platform ceiling is a technical limit; the effective length is decided by whether people watch, which is settled in the first couple of seconds. This is the same distinction covered in detail for Instagram Reel length.

Captions are effectively mandatory

The large majority of feed video is watched with sound off. A video whose meaning depends on audio is a video most viewers do not receive. Burn captions in or supply an accurate caption file for every video asset without exception.

How to produce assets that fit every placement
Step one is the whole method. Framing for the tallest crop and cutting down produces usable assets in every ratio; framing horizontally and cropping up produces a subject with no head.

What are the safe zones and where exactly are they?

Roughly the top fourteen percent and the bottom twenty percent of a 9:16 frame, where profile information, captions and call-to-action elements are drawn over your creative.

Exact figures shift as interfaces change, which is why the practical instruction is to keep essential text and logos within the middle portion of the frame rather than to memorise a percentage. Anything you would be unhappy to have covered belongs in the center band.

Safe zones differ between Stories and Reels

Reels carry more persistent interface furniture along the bottom than Stories do, including captions, audio attribution and interaction controls. An asset designed against the Stories safe zone can still lose its bottom line of text in Reels, which is why checking each crop separately is worth the two minutes.

The center band is smaller than it looks

After both safe zones, the usable area in a vertical asset is roughly two-thirds of the frame. Designing as though the whole frame is available and then discovering the constraint at upload is the most common production failure in this format.

Placements plotted by reach and by how specific the creative needs to be
Reels sits top-right: high share of delivery and high creative specificity. It is the placement where reusing a feed asset costs the most, and the one most often served a recycled crop.

Which placements actually deliver most of the impressions?

Facebook and Instagram feeds and Reels carry the large majority. Audience Network, right column and several minor placements exist and rarely justify bespoke creative.

This matters for production budgets. Making a genuinely distinct asset for a placement receiving a small share of delivery is effort spent where it cannot pay back, while reusing a feed asset in Reels — a major placement — is a saving made in exactly the wrong place.

Where automatic placement helps and where it does not

Letting the system choose placements generally improves efficiency because it can move budget toward whatever is working. It cannot invent creative that fits a surface it did not receive, so automatic placement plus a single square asset delivers into vertical surfaces with an asset that does not belong there.

Carousels take two to ten cards, each 1:1 or 4:5, each with its own headline and destination. Collections use a cover image or video plus a product grid drawn from a catalog.

Multi-asset formats and when each earns its place
FormatStructureSuitsCommon mistake
Carousel2-10 cards, each its own linkMultiple products, sequential storyOne image sliced across cards for no reason
CollectionCover asset plus catalog gridEcommerce with a real catalogUsing it without catalog hygiene
Single imageOne assetMost casesAssuming more formats means better results
Single videoOne assetDemonstration, story, motionRepurposed horizontal footage
Instant ExperienceFull-screen post-click canvasHigh-consideration productsBuilding one instead of fixing the landing page

Carousels are frequently used because they exist rather than because the content is sequential. If the cards do not benefit from order, a single strong asset usually does better and costs less to produce.

Cards have their own headlines and destinations, which makes a carousel a small campaign rather than one ad. Writing one headline and repeating it across ten cards wastes the format’s only real advantage.

How should you produce assets efficiently across all this?

Shoot and frame vertically for 9:16, export that master, then crop down to 4:5 and 1:1. One production pass covers every ratio that matters.

Working in the other direction — shooting horizontally and cropping upward — either loses the subject or forces a letterbox. Framing decisions made at capture are far cheaper than crops attempted afterwards, which is why the specification conversation belongs in the brief rather than the edit.

Leave headroom you do not think you need

Composing tightly for the 9:16 frame leaves nothing to give up when the 4:5 crop takes width from the sides. Shooting slightly wider than the tightest intended crop is the practical insurance against discovering the problem in post.

Version control matters more than it sounds

Three ratios, several lengths and multiple captions produce a lot of files quickly. Naming conventions that encode ratio and version prevent the recurring failure of the wrong crop going live in the wrong placement, which nobody notices for a week.

Do specifications actually affect performance, or just appearance?

Some do measurably. Screen space, safe zone compliance and caption presence all affect whether an ad is seen and understood; codec and container do not, provided you stay inside the limits.

The useful distinction is between specifications that are thresholds and specifications that are choices. Thresholds — file size, container, codec, minimum resolution — either pass or fail and have no effect once passed. Choices — ratio, safe zone use, captions, opening frame — sit on a continuum and are where design effort pays back.

Do not confuse compliance with quality

An asset can satisfy every published specification and still be poor creative. The specification sheet sets a floor; nothing on it will make an ad good, and several things on it will stop a good ad from being seen properly.

How often do Meta ad specs change?

Frequently enough that any specification page, including this one, is a snapshot. Check Meta’s own guidance before a production run rather than relying on a third-party summary.

What has been stable is the direction of travel: toward vertical, toward video, toward full-screen surfaces, and toward the platform handling more adaptation automatically. Designing vertically and captioning everything has stayed correct through every revision, which makes it a safer default than any particular number.

Thumbnails are a specification nobody publishes

Video thumbnails are selected automatically unless you supply one, and the automatic choice is frequently a blurred transition frame. Supplying a deliberate thumbnail at the same dimensions as the video costs nothing and is the most commonly skipped production step.

Sound design still matters even though sound is off

A meaningful proportion of Reels viewing does have audio on, and the platform surfaces audio-led content differently. Designing so the video works silently and rewards unmuting is better than designing for either state alone.

Check the render, not the export

Assets look different inside the platform than in a design tool, because of compression, interface overlay and screen size. Previewing the actual ad in the placement preview before publishing catches problems no specification sheet describes.

Are Facebook ad specs and Instagram ad specs different?

They overlap almost entirely. Searches for facebook ad specs and instagram ad specs land on the same requirements, because both platforms are served from one advertising system with shared creative rules.

Where they genuinely differ is placement mix rather than specification. Instagram delivers more heavily into Stories and Reels, so an Instagram-weighted campaign needs vertical assets more urgently than a Facebook-weighted one. The dimensions themselves are the same numbers.

Why the two terms persist separately

Habit, mostly. Advertisers who started on one platform search for that platform’s name, and specification articles are titled to match. Treating them as one specification sheet with different placement weightings is more accurate than maintaining two mental models.

When Instagram-specific thinking does matter

Reels-first creative, audio choices and the visual conventions of the surface differ enough that an asset which works in a Facebook feed can look out of place in an Instagram Reel. That is a creative difference rather than a dimension one, which is why the specification sheet does not capture it.

One production pass still covers both

Because the ratios are shared, the vertical-first workflow described above produces everything both platforms need. There is no separate Instagram export step beyond checking the Reels safe zone, which differs slightly from Stories.

What are the current Facebook ad sizes in pixels?

1080 by 1350 for 4:5, 1080 by 1080 for square, 1080 by 1920 for 9:16, and 1200 by 628 for the 1.91:1 landscape placements. Those four cover essentially everything.

Facebook ad sizes in pixels, and where each is used
RatioPixel sizePrimary useWorth producing?
4:51080 x 1350Facebook and Instagram feedYes, the default
9:161080 x 1920Stories, Reels, vertical videoYes, always
1:11080 x 1080Fallback, Marketplace, some gridsSometimes
1.91:11200 x 628Link previews, right columnRarely worth a bespoke asset
16:91920 x 1080Legacy horizontal videoOnly if the footage already exists
2:31080 x 1620Occasional vertical variantNo, 4:5 and 9:16 cover it

Anyone looking up facebook ad sizes is usually about to open a design tool, so the pixel column is the operative one. Set the canvas at these dimensions rather than scaling up from smaller artboards, because upscaling produces exactly the softness the minimum-resolution guidance exists to prevent.

Why 1080 keeps appearing

It is the width at which assets render cleanly on high-density phone screens without producing files large enough to cause upload friction. Every ratio in the table is simply 1080 wide with the height that ratio implies, which makes the whole set easy to remember.

What ad options does Instagram actually offer, and how do the specs differ?

Six placement types with different requirements: feed, Stories, Reels, Explore, Shop and the in-stream options. They share the underlying specification sheet and differ in ratio and in what the interface draws over your creative.

Instagram ad options and what each requires
OptionRatioFormatWhat it suitsWatch for
Feed image or video4:5 or 1:1Image or videoAlmost anything4:5 uses more screen than square
Stories9:16Image or videoFull-screen interruptionBoth safe zones
Reels9:16VideoDemonstration and reachHeavier bottom interface than Stories
Explore4:5 or 1:1Image or videoDiscovery audiencesBehaves like feed
Carousel1:1 or 4:52-10 cardsSequential or multi-productEach card is its own decision
Collection and ShopCover plus catalog gridMixedEcommerce with a real catalogCatalog hygiene decides it

Because the placements share one specification system, producing a 9:16 master and cropping to 4:5 covers every row in that table. The differences that actually bite are the safe zones and whether static or video suits the surface, not the dimensions themselves.

Static images underperform in Reels specifically

Reels is a video surface and a still image placed there reads as an advertisement immediately. Where budget forces a choice, put video into Reels and static into feed rather than distributing one asset evenly.

Do ad specifications affect engagement rates?

Indirectly and measurably. Specifications decide how much screen the ad occupies, whether the text is readable and whether it works muted — all of which affect whether anybody engages at all.

Which specification decisions plausibly affect engagement, and which do not
DecisionEffect on engagementWhy
4:5 instead of 1:1 in feedRealMore screen space at the moment of scrolling
9:16 instead of a cropped feed asset in ReelsSubstantialA letterboxed asset reads as recycled
Captions on videoSubstantialMost feed viewing is muted
Text clear of safe zonesRealCovered text conveys nothing
Opening frame contentSubstantialAttention is granted in the first seconds
Codec and containerNoneA threshold, not a variable
File size under the ceilingNoneSame
Uploading above minimum resolutionSmallPrevents visible softness, no more

The bottom three rows are worth stating explicitly because they absorb attention in production conversations. Once a file passes the technical thresholds, nothing further about the file affects performance — the remaining variables are all compositional.

Engagement rate is a weak measure for paid anyway

Likes and comments on an advertisement rarely predict sales, and optimizing creative for them can actively work against conversion. Cost per acquisition and contribution after media cost are the numbers that matter; engagement is a diagnostic at best.

Frequently asked questions

What are the current link ads specs on Meta?
1080 by 1080 or 1080 by 1350 for feed, with text limits that vary by placement. Link ads specs matter less than they once did because Meta now crops and adapts automatically, but supplying the exact ratio avoids the platform making that decision for you. Keep critical text out of the outer ten per cent.
What are the meta reels specs for advertising?
1080 by 1920, nine by sixteen, with safe zones top and bottom. Meta reels specs require more caution than feed because the interface overlays the frame: roughly 14 per cent at the top and 20 per cent at the bottom can be obscured. Design the message into the middle band.
What are the meta story ad specs and how do they differ from Reels?
Same 1080 by 1920 canvas, different safe area and duration. Meta story ad specs share the nine by sixteen ratio with Reels but tolerate shorter durations and place interface elements differently, so a single export rarely serves both perfectly. Producing two crops from one master is the practical compromise.
Are fb link ad specs the same as Instagram’s?
Broadly, with placement-level exceptions. Fb link ad specs and Instagram’s overlap because both are configured in the same Ads Manager, but headline and description fields display differently and some placements truncate earlier. Preview every placement rather than trusting one render.
Where do I find authoritative facebook ad specifications?
Meta’s own Ads Guide, which is the only version that stays current. Published facebook ad specifications age badly because Meta revises placements several times a year, so any third-party table — including this one — should be checked against the official guide before a production run.
What are meta static ad specs for feed placements?
1080 by 1080 square or 1080 by 1350 vertical, JPG or PNG, under 30MB. Meta static ad specs are permissive on file size and strict on nothing much, which misleads people into supplying low-resolution assets that Meta then upscales badly. Supply at the full pixel dimensions rather than relying on the platform.
What are the Meta ad specs that actually matter?
Five: 4:5 in feed, 9:16 in Stories and Reels, text kept clear of safe zones, uploading at source quality, and captions on every video. The rest of the sheet is limits rather than decisions.
What is the best aspect ratio for Facebook and Instagram feed ads?
4:5. It occupies more vertical screen space on a phone than a 1:1 square does, and screen space is one of the few things creative controls outright.
What ratio should Stories and Reels ads be?
9:16, full frame. These are full-screen surfaces, and anything narrower is either letterboxed or cropped automatically in a way the designer did not choose.
What is the minimum image resolution for Meta ads?
Around 1080 pixels wide. Larger is fine and usually better, because rendering size varies and high-density screens make anything smaller look soft.
Is there still a twenty percent text limit on images?
No. Meta removed that enforcement. Heavy text still tends to perform worse because it reads as an advertisement at a glance, so it is now a design judgement rather than a policy constraint.
What video format should I upload?
MP4 or MOV with H.264 video and AAC audio, which is the default export from essentially every editor. Upload the highest quality master you have rather than compressing first.
Should I compress video before uploading?
No. The platform re-encodes everything, so pre-compressing means two rounds of compression and visible artefacts baked in before the platform’s pass even starts.
Where exactly are the safe zones?
Roughly the top fourteen percent and bottom twenty percent of a 9:16 frame, where profile information, captions and buttons are drawn over the creative. Exact figures move, so design to the middle band.
Do Stories and Reels have the same safe zones?
Not quite. Reels carries more persistent interface elements along the bottom, so an asset checked only against Stories can still lose its bottom line of text. Check each crop separately.
Do I need captions on video ads?
In practice, yes. Most feed video is watched muted, so a video whose meaning depends on audio is a video most viewers never actually receive.
Can I use one square asset for every placement?
You can, and it costs you. Square loses screen space in feed against 4:5 and does not fill vertical surfaces at all, which makes it the cheapest option and rarely the best one.
How do I produce assets for all ratios without multiple shoots?
Frame and shoot for 9:16 with a safe center, export that master, then crop down to 4:5 and 1:1. Cropping down works; cropping upward from horizontal does not.
What are the carousel specifications?
Two to ten cards, each 1:1 or 4:5, each with its own headline and destination link. Treat it as a small campaign rather than one ad, or the format’s advantage is wasted.
When is a carousel the wrong format?
When the cards are not sequential and gain nothing from order. A single strong asset usually performs better and costs less than a carousel built because the format was available.
Which placements carry most of the impressions?
Facebook and Instagram feeds and Reels carry the large majority. Audience Network, right column and minor placements rarely justify bespoke creative.
Does automatic placement mean I can ignore specs?
No. Automatic placement moves budget toward what works, but it cannot create an asset for a surface it was never given. Automatic placement with only a square asset delivers into vertical surfaces badly.
How long can a Meta video ad be?
Far longer than is useful. Placement limits are technical ceilings; the effective length is decided by whether people keep watching, which is settled in the first couple of seconds.
Do specifications actually affect performance?
Some do. Screen space, safe zone compliance and captions affect whether an ad is seen and understood. Container, codec and file size are thresholds — once you pass them, they have no further effect.
What is the most common specification mistake?
Reusing one feed asset across every placement, particularly in Reels, which is both a major placement and the one where a recycled crop looks most obviously recycled.
Why does my video look worse after uploading?
Platform re-encoding, usually made worse by compressing before upload. Upload the master, and avoid exporting from an already-exported file.
How often do Meta ad specs change?
Often enough that every specification page is a snapshot. The direction has been consistent — vertical, video, full-screen — so designing vertically and captioning everything survives revisions better than memorising numbers.
Where should I check the authoritative specs?
Meta’s own advertising specification documentation, immediately before a production run. Third-party summaries, including this one, lag behind changes that are made without notice.
